KISS band members used a little-known therapy created by a Vancouver biomedical firm to keep away from getting COVID, after lead singer Paul Stanley examined optimistic for the virus, and to keep away from having to cancel the legendary band’s farewell world tour, their supervisor says.
“It could be unimaginable, not inconceivable, however unimaginable, for KISS to proceed on its world tour with out the safety of the Steriwave therapy,” supervisor Doc McGhee mentioned in a press launch.
Steriwave, created by Vancouver-based Ondine Biomedical, makes use of a light-activated disinfecting liquid to kill viruses within the nostril, and is utilized by hospitals reminiscent of Vancouver Basic to cut back infections in surgical procedure sufferers. Final Thursday, a research was launched exhibiting the usage of this “nasal photodisinfection” at Ottawa Hospital lowered the size of sufferers’ hospital stays, readmissions and antibiotic use.
When the pandemic struck, a Toronto surgeon quietly started utilizing Steriwave to see if it could additionally kill COVID, and forestall sufferers from contracting the virus. Outcomes of a small medical research, launched in January , discovered the therapy lowered COVID infections and lessened the development of signs in those that had the virus.
Among the many 344 sufferers to whom Toronto surgeon Dr. Jack Kolenda supplied the therapy had been all 4 members of the KISS band plus a lot of their help crew, after lead singer Paul Stanley contracted the virus in August 2021 in Philadelphia, throughout a cease on the band’s large Finish of the Street World Tour. The band cancelled a number of reveals however had been in a position to proceed with the multi-country tour, which features a cease in Vancouver on Nov. 8 , with the assistance of Kolenda and his remedies, mentioned McGhee.

The “hero” of the Steriwave story, Cross says, is Kolenda, an ear, nostril and throat physician who used Steriwave to guard his sufferers from contracting post-surgery infections whereas in hospital, such because the lethal Candida auris . Through the pandemic he experimented by utilizing the therapy on himself and colleagues in his surgical procedure centre, who had been all extraordinarily uncovered to COVID as a result of they operated on areas of the physique that usually contained the virus.
“After which he thought to strive it for treating individuals with COVID as an alternative of simply stopping it, and located it labored,” Cross mentioned.
Kolenda began to quietly provide the service to others who knew about his efforts, together with the KISS members. This work led to scientific trials at Sunnybrook Hospital in Toronto and the College of Navarra in Spain , which each discovered the therapy lowered coronavirus infectivity and suppressed signs.
“The therapy protocol required KISS and its administration and crew to deal with themselves with the Steriwave therapy for 4 minutes each present day, which is the very same therapy protocol that has been used at Vancouver Basic Hospital, as the usual of take care of greater than 12 years, to deal with virtually all sufferers previous to surgical procedure, to guard towards the unfold of MRSA and different hospital acquired infections,” says a launch issued earlier than Monday’s press convention.
